Какое условие является основой для данного условного оператора

  • 15
Какое условие является основой для данного условного оператора: if a<17 then y:=a else y:=a+3. Варианты ответа: y:=a, y:=a+3, a<17, все ответы верные.
Polyarnaya
53
Условие, являющееся основой для данного условного оператора "if a", представляет собой логическое выражение, которое проверяет истинность/ложность переменной "a". Если это выражение истинно, то код, следующий за оператором "if", выполняется. Если же выражение ложно, то код, следующий за оператором "if", пропускается и выполняется код после оператора "else" (если такой есть).

Оператор "if" часто используется в программировании для контроля выполнения определенных частей кода в зависимости от условий. Чтобы понять, какое условие может быть использовано в операторе "if a", необходимо знать, какие типы данных может принимать переменная "a". Рассмотрим несколько примеров:

1. Проверка равенства:
- `if a == 5` - код после оператора "if" будет выполняться только в том случае, если значение переменной "a" равно 5.

2. Проверка неравенства:
- `if a != 0` - код после оператора "if" будет выполняться только в том случае, если значение переменной "a" не равно 0.

3. Проверка больше/меньше:
- `if a > 10` - код после оператора "if" будет выполняться только в том случае, если значение переменной "a" больше 10.
- `if a < 20` - код после оператора "if" будет выполняться только в том случае, если значение переменной "a" меньше 20.

4. Проверка наличия значения:
- `if a is not None` - код после оператора "if" будет выполняться только в том случае, если переменная "a" имеет какое-либо значение (не равно "None").

Это лишь некоторые примеры условий, которые можно использовать в операторе "if a". В действительности, условия могут быть гораздо более сложными и содержать различные операторы сравнения, логические операторы и функции. Важно понимать требования конкретной задачи или программы, чтобы определить правильное условие для оператора "if a".